Not only does Thirdspace host beautiful storefront windows letting in tons of natural light but their shop is open, airy, with high vaulted ceiling and minimalistic decor. The atmosphere is relaxed and easy going, without fail the baristas always bring good energy to me when I walk in the shop. In the back of their space they have available for public use a happy lamp and board games so you can soak up those UV rays while doing work or playing with friends. They always have a great sampler latte board on deck so check it out and take some time to unwind.

To truly get away from the Minnesotan cold, check out a newer addition to the Minneapolis coffee scene, Cafe Ceres. This Turkish inspired cafe is both warm and welcoming. House made delicious Turkish pastries and coffee warms us up every time. They house beautiful plants, windows, and an airy tropical atmosphere with ever pleasant staff. To be transported to a warm, mediterranean paradise, be sure to visit.

If you want to feel connected to nature, this is the shop for you. These are the plants of your dreams. This Spyhouse, located in the lobby of Hotel Emery, is a movie-like experience. It seriously feels like you are stepping into a jungle. Floor to ceiling plants with absolutely gorgeous wooden tables and chairs, plenty of pillows, an electric fireplace, and a pool table. Although this shop lacks natural light, it will help you feel right at home among the nature or living plants
